# ValidKit Environments

ValidKit runs three environments for plugin authors: sandbox, certification, and production. Sandbox accepts unsigned validator plugins and resets nightly; certification mirrors production limits and is where your plugin must pass the conformance suite before listing. Production only loads signed, certified plugins. Rate limits and schema cache behavior differ per environment, so test against certification before release. The certification environment currently runs with these settings.

settings of bawif-fawif:
ralix:
  log_level: warn
  metrics_host: metrics.ralix.tolvaqsys.internal
  pool_size: 32

## Break-Glass Access — Flagwright Rollout Framework

If Flagwright's control plane is unreachable and a bad flag is burning prod, you can force-disable rollouts locally. Yes, it's scary; no, don't wait for Dara's team to wake up. Run the break-glass CLI from the ops bastion and kill the offending cohort. The emergency unlock prompt expects the passphrase below.

unlock words, hahip-baduf: holwyn-istath-julvan

## Tuning

The Verdanta scheduler decides when each zone is watered by combining soil-moisture readings with a decay model. Future maintainers: resist the urge to tweak these casually, since the greenhouse beds at the Oakhollow test site took three seasons to calibrate. Lower thresholds mean wetter soil; higher evaporation coefficients make the model more aggressive in summer. All values are read at startup from the table that follows:

tuning table, bagep-tahof:
RATE_LIMITS = {
    "ralael": 10,
    "druath": 5,
}

**14:22 — Cutoff rule fires early**

So here's where it got weird: Crumbwell's order-cutoff rule (no custom cakes after 2pm for next-day pickup) started rejecting orders at 1pm. Turns out the Ovenline scheduler was comparing UTC against local bakery time after the config push. On-call rolled back and orders flowed again by 14:40. If it recurs, grab the scheduler logs and match against the token below.

pipeline stamp: htk6_35e0c9